Patent number: 8524269Abstract: The present invention provides oral dosage compositions, and methods of making thereof, which contain an edible oil, preferably containing an omega-3 fatty acid, and admixed therein one or more water soluble vitamins and/or minerals, for example vitamins B6, B9, and/or B12. The present invention also provides a method of making the composition comprising mixing the edible oil and one or more water-soluble vitamins and/or minerals to form a suspension or emulsion of the water-soluble vitamins and/or minerals in the edible oil. The mixture can be inserted into capsules, gelcaps, or caplets for oral consumption. An additional aspect of the invention is that the edible oil can coat particles of the water-soluble vitamins and/or minerals, which may preferably provide the vitamins and/or minerals improved absorption in the body due to increased resistance to degradation in the acidic environment of the stomach.Type: GrantFiled: November 7, 2011Date of Patent: September 3, 2013Assignee: PBM Pharmaceuticals, Inc.Inventors: Jack H. Schramm, James W. McGrath, Jr.

Patent number: 8173160Abstract: The invention provides compositions for an administration to a mammal orally or in a suppository that include one or more edible oils (preferably including one or more omega-3 fatty acids), one or more plant stanols, phytosterols, or esters thereof, and admixed in the one or more edible oils one or more water-soluble vitamins and/or minerals, for example, vitamins B6, B9 and/or B12. The invention also provides a method of making the compositions comprising mixing the foregoing components to form a suspension or emulsion of the vitamins and/or minerals in the edible oils. The mixture can be inserted into hollow soft or hard capsules, gelcaps or caplets. The edible oils can coat particles of the water-soluble vitamins and/or minerals, which may provide them with an improved absorption in the body due to an increased resistance to degradation in the acidic environment of the stomach.Type: GrantFiled: May 18, 2005Date of Patent: May 8, 2012Assignee: PBM Pharmaceuticals, Inc.Inventors: Jack H. Schramm, James W. McGrath, Jr.

Patent number: 6576253Abstract: The present invention provides food bars for consumption by pregnant women, lactating women or women of childbearing potential that are attempting to become pregnant containing one or more vitamins and/or minerals, DHA, one or more DHA taste-masking agents and, optionally, one or more anti-constipation and regularity-maintaining agents, methods for preparing these food bars, and methods for supplementing the dietary requirements of pregnant women, lactating women or women of childbearing potential that are attempting to become pregnant.Type: GrantFiled: February 19, 2002Date of Patent: June 10, 2003Assignee: PBM Pharmaceuticals, Inc.Inventors: Paul B. Manning, Jack H. Schramm, James W. McGrath, Jr.
